Understanding the Power Duo: GenAI and Automation

To fully appreciate their impact, it is essential to understand the distinct yet complementary roles of Generative AI and automation. They are not interchangeable technologies; rather, they form a strategic partnership where each enhances the capabilities of the other.

What is GenAI?

GenAI creates new and original content. Its capabilities extend far beyond simple text or image generation. GenAI models are trained on vast datasets, allowing them to understand context, recognize patterns, and make sophisticated, data-driven decisions. They can draft marketing copy, write software code, design product mockups, and analyze complex information to produce actionable insights.

Essentially, GenAI provides the intelligence and creativity that augment human decision-making and elevate the quality of output.

The Role of Automation

Automation focuses on executing tasks and processes with speed, consistency, and scale. This includes Robotic Process Automation (RPA) for handling rules-based digital tasks, workflow orchestration for managing complex business processes, and AI-driven bots for interacting with systems and users. Automation is the engine that takes strategic directives and implements them efficiently, removing manual intervention and ensuring that processes run smoothly and without delay.

GenAI provides the strategic direction; automation ensures flawless execution. When combined, they enable businesses to operate not just faster, but smarter—without inflating their operational costs.

Key Ways GenAI and Automation Drive Down Costs

The integration of GenAI and automation delivers substantial cost savings across multiple business functions. Here are the primary ways this powerful combination reduces expenses.

Reduced Manual Effort

The most immediate impact is the automation of repetitive, rules-based tasks. Functions like data entry, invoice processing, and report generation can be handled entirely by automated systems guided by AI. This frees employees from mundane work, allowing them to focus on higher-value strategic initiatives.

Lower Error Rates

Manual processes are inherently susceptible to human error, which can lead to costly mistakes, compliance risks, and rework. AI-powered automation executes tasks with near-perfect accuracy, ensuring consistency and adherence to predefined rules. This reduction in errors translates directly to lower operational costs and improved quality control.

Optimized Resource Utilization

According to Morgan Stanley, AI adoption in the U.S. could generate $920 billion in annual savings, primarily through optimized labour costs.

GenAI can analyse vast amounts of operational data to guide the allocation of both human and capital resources. For example, AI can predict demand fluctuations to optimize inventory levels, schedule predictive maintenance to prevent costly equipment downtime, and allocate staff based on anticipated workloads. This intelligent resource management ensures that assets are used efficiently, minimizing waste and maximizing productivity.

Cost-Effective Customer Service

Customer support is another area ripe for cost reduction. GenAI-powered chatbots and virtual assistants can handle a large volume of customer inquiries 24/7 without human intervention. McKinsey suggests that GenAI could reduce the need for human-handled customer contacts by up to 50%, improving productivity by 30–45% in customer operations. These systems can answer common questions, guide users through troubleshooting steps, and escalate complex issues to human agents, leading to a more efficient and scalable support model.

How GenAI and Automation Accelerate Innovation

Beyond cost savings, the synergy between GenAI and automation is a powerful catalyst for innovation. By removing bottlenecks and empowering teams with intelligent tools, organizations can bring new ideas to market faster than ever before.

Faster Prototyping and Experimentation

GenAI models can generate product designs, software mockups, marketing content, and even functional code in a fraction of the time it would take a human team. This allows organizations to move from concept to prototype almost instantly. For instance, a marketing team could use GenAI to create dozens of ad variations for A/B testing, while automation can deploy these campaigns and gather performance data automatically. This rapid iteration cycle enables businesses to test hypotheses quickly and refine their strategies based on real-world feedback.

Smarter, Data-Driven Decision-Making

AI algorithms can analyze market trends, customer feedback, and competitive intelligence to provide actionable insights that guide strategic decisions. This allows organizations to identify emerging opportunities, anticipate market shifts, and pivot their strategies with confidence. When these insights are fed into automated workflows, businesses can respond to changing conditions in real time. For example, an eCommerce platform could use AI to adjust pricing dynamically based on competitor actions and customer demand.

Agile and Democratized Innovation

The rise of no-code and low-code platforms integrated with GenAI empowers non-technical teams to build and deploy their own solutions. This "democratization" of innovation means that employees across the organization can experiment with new ideas without relying on IT departments. A sales team could build a custom automation to streamline its lead qualification process, or a finance team could create an AI-powered tool to detect anomalies in expense reports. This fosters a culture of continuous improvement and accelerates innovation from the ground up.

Real-World Case Studies

The transformative impact of GenAI and automation is not theoretical. Leading organizations across various sectors are already reaping the benefits.

  • Technology: Tech companies are using AI to automate software testing and deployment, significantly reducing development cycles. Telstra, an Australian telecommunications giant, plans to leverage AI-driven gains in software development and autonomous operations to optimize its workforce and cut significant operational costs.
  • Healthcare and Pharmaceuticals: In an industry where R&D costs are notoriously high, GenAI is being used to accelerate drug discovery by analyzing biological data and simulating molecular interactions. Automation then streamlines clinical trial data collection and analysis. This combination is shortening development timelines and reducing the immense costs associated with bringing a new drug to market.
  • Financial Services: Banks and insurance companies are automating compliance monitoring and fraud detection with AI. GenAI can analyze transaction patterns in real time to identify suspicious activity, while automation can flag or block transactions that meet certain risk criteria. For example, Zurich employs AI to predict likely claim outcomes early, helping to identify cases for early intervention, which reduces cost and loss severity.

Challenges and Strategic Considerations

Despite the immense potential, the journey to integrating GenAI and automation is not without its challenges. Successful adoption requires careful planning and strategic oversight.

  • Data Quality and Governance: AI models are only as good as the data they are trained on. Organizations must ensure they have high-quality, well-governed data to avoid biased or inaccurate outcomes.
  • Change Management and Employee Adoption: The introduction of new technologies can be disruptive. Leaders must manage the transition carefully, providing training and clear communication to ensure employees embrace new tools and workflows. Concerns about job displacement should be addressed proactively by focusing on upskilling and redeploying talent to higher-value roles.
  • Balancing Efficiency with Human Oversight: While automation can handle many tasks, human creativity, critical thinking, and ethical judgment remain indispensable. It is crucial to strike the right balance, using AI to augment human capabilities rather than replace them entirely.
  • Avoiding the Experimentation Trap: McKinsey finds that 90% of AI projects stall in the experimentation phase. To avoid this, organizations should centralize governance and ensure that pilot projects are aligned with clear business outcomes, allowing for successful scaling.
